The Location

Gressenhall is a charming and highly regarded village set just outside Dereham, enjoying a peaceful position within the beautiful Norfolk countryside. Surrounded by open fields, quiet lanes, and pockets of woodland, it offers a wonderful sense of space and tranquillity, making it particularly appealing to those looking for a slower, more relaxed pace of life without feeling isolated.

The village itself is steeped in local heritage, most notably being home to the well-known Gressenhall Farm and Workhouse, a popular attraction that provides a fascinating insight into Norfolk’s rural and social history. This adds a strong sense of character to the area, blending its historic roots with a welcoming community atmosphere.

Despite its rural feel, Gressenhall benefits from excellent proximity to Dereham, which is just a short drive away. Here, a wide range of everyday amenities can be found, including supermarkets, independent shops, cafes, schools, and healthcare facilities. The nearby town also offers regular transport connections, making access to Norwich straightforward for commuting, shopping, or leisure.

The surrounding countryside is ideal for outdoor pursuits, with scenic walking routes, cycling paths, and bridleways all close at hand. Whether it’s a relaxed evening stroll, dog walking, or simply enjoying the changing seasons, the natural setting is a real highlight of village life.
